The main difference between bitmap and vector images is how the image is constructed- bitmaps are blocks of colors assembled in a grid format while vectors are shapes and colors built on mathematical formulas. There are inherent benefits and restrictions to each that make one more suitable for printing photographs and the other better at displaying web icons.
